Frequently Asked Questions About Estate Planning Attorneys
The following questions appear regularly when individuals first consult with an estate planning attorney. Our responses below to help you understand what to expect from the start.
What is the difference between a will and a living trust?A last will and testament requires court supervision before your estate can be settled, while a living trust distributes property immediately. Each instrument has its place, and many clients benefit from having both. An estate planning attorney can help you decide which structure best fits your goals.
Is estate planning expensive?Pricing is influenced by the scope of the documents needed. A straightforward will and power of attorney tends to be quite affordable than a complex multi-document strategy. When you first meet with us, we outline all costs upfront so you can plan accordingly.
When should I update my estate plan?Your plan should be updated after any major life event — including marriage or divorce. Regardless of life events, most estate planning attorneys recommend a review every three to five years to make sure nothing has been missed.
What role does an estate planning attorney play in long-term care planning?Medicaid asset protection strategies is an often-overlooked aspect of a complete planning strategy. Certain irrevocable arrangements can protect assets from Medi-Cal recovery even after extended care is required. This is a specialized area, so consulting a knowledgeable attorney is strongly recommended.
